I wouldn't redo your first chapters, because we all progress and evolve with time. It's normal.
There's not much of a difference between the first episode and the latest one. I can see it's a bit more polished, but the style doesn't jump all over the place. If it was drastic, I'd say to redo it.
I tweaked my first chapter when I reprinted a couple of years ago. But, I didn't redo all of it. It would be too much work and I progressed so much in 5 years that it would be too noticeable to go that far back. Tweaking, wasn't so noticeable. As long as you evolve gradually, it's not that noticeable from one chapter to another. It's only really noticeable when you look back many years. Generally, readers like to see how an artist grows as the story moves forward.
Sometimes, not all pages are amazing, but if the overall artwork is consistent, you're good. I know some pages of my first chapter are not great, but the first few pages are strong, so I'm good. We all have our good days and our bad days.
